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of boilers, in particular to a method for controlling the flow of desuperheating water of a superheater at a low-load section of a boiler.
Background
The steam temperature of the boiler is one of the most important parameters influencing the safety and the economical efficiency of the production process of the boiler, overhigh temperature of superheated steam causes overhigh metal temperature and creep expansion enhancement, the service life of a pipeline is shortened, and overtemperature pipe explosion of a superheater pipeline can be caused frequently. The heat efficiency of the whole plant can be reduced when the temperature of the superheated steam is too low, and the heat efficiency is reduced by 1 percent when the temperature of the superheater steam is reduced by 5-10 ℃. The operating regulations require that the control of the superheated steam temperature not exceed-10 to 5 ℃ of the nominal value (set point). The steam temperature control object has the characteristics of large inertia, large lag, nonlinearity and strong coupling, and in addition, factors influencing the steam temperature are many, such as boiler load, fuel quantity, flue gas disturbance (powder making during start and stop), temperature-reducing water quantity (water supply pressure) and the like.
The retrieval publication (announcement) number CN107463739B discloses a desuperheating water flow analysis method and a desuperheating water flow analysis device, when the method is used, a quantitative relation between steam temperature deviation and desuperheating water flow is established, correction analysis of desuperheating water flow is realized, and the influence of flue gas side steam temperature regulation operation on unit operation economy is quantitatively evaluated by using a uniform index;
the numerical values of the high-pressure bypass steam leakage amount and the high-pressure bypass desuperheating water flow amount of the steam turbine generator unit are calculated in a mode of combining site measurement and theoretical calculation, so that the influence value of the high-bypass steam leakage amount and the high-bypass desuperheating water investment on the unit operation economy can be specifically analyzed, and the heat consumption rate of the unit during operation is accurately calculated.
The above scheme still has the following technical defects:
at present, when steam in the superheater is adjusted, the temperature of the steam after temperature reduction is adjusted only by simply controlling the water quantity of the temperature reduction water, but when the method is used for greatly adjusting the steam temperature of the boiler, the required time is long, and the working efficiency of the boiler is reduced.
Disclosure of Invention
Technical scheme (I)
In order to achieve the purposes of reducing the time required by temperature adjustment and improving the working efficiency of the boiler, the invention provides the following technical scheme: a method for controlling the flow of desuperheating water of a low-load section superheater of a boiler comprises the following steps:
the method comprises the following steps: adding a low-temperature section boiler and a high-temperature section boiler, preheating water in the low-temperature section boiler and the high-temperature section boiler, wherein outlet ends of the low-temperature section boiler and the high-temperature section boiler are respectively and commonly connected with two inlet ends of a three-way head through first pipelines, the other outlet end of the three-way head is connected with a main boiler, the outlet end of the main boiler is connected with the inlet end of a superheater through a second pipeline, and water pumps are respectively arranged on the two first pipelines;
step two: monitoring the temperature of steam in the superheater through a temperature monitor, and setting a standard temperature value section for the steam in the superheater according to production requirements;
step three: when the temperature of steam in the superheater exceeds a standard temperature value section, starting a water pump in a first pipeline connected with the low-temperature section boiler, transporting water in the low-temperature section boiler into a main boiler, and quickly cooling water in the main boiler;
step four: when the temperature of steam in the superheater is lower than a standard temperature value section, a water pump in a first pipeline connected with the high-temperature section boiler is started, water in the high-temperature section boiler is transported to the main boiler, and the water in the main boiler is rapidly heated.
Preferably, two all install the check valve in the first pipeline, the output of check valve is close to main boiler setting.
Preferably, the second pipeline is provided with a control valve.
Preferably, the low-temperature section boiler and the high-temperature section boiler are both provided with water circulation devices, and generated water vapor is condensed and then sent back.
Preferably, the main boiler is connected with a water replenishing port and a temperature detector.
Preferably, the low-temperature section boiler and the high-temperature section boiler are both provided with water inlets.
Preferably, a filtering device for filtering water is installed in each of the water replenishing port and the water inlet.
(II) advantageous effects
Compared with the prior art, the invention provides a method for controlling the flow of desuperheating water of a low-load section superheater of a boiler, which has the following beneficial effects:
according to the control method for the desuperheating water flow of the superheater of the low-load section of the boiler, the low-temperature section boiler and the high-temperature section boiler are additionally arranged, when the steam temperature in the superheater exceeds a standard temperature value section, water in the low-temperature section boiler or the high-temperature section boiler is transported to the main boiler, the water in the main boiler is rapidly heated, the steam temperature after desuperheating is not simply adjusted by controlling the water quantity of the desuperheating water, the time required by temperature adjustment is shortened, and the working efficiency of the boiler is improved.
